Pledge to Fair Gaming and RNG Validation

Honest gaming means every game result is fully random. The casino cannot influence it. Lotto Casino backs this concept with certified Random Number Generator (RNG) software in all its slots, table games, and video poker. An RNG is a advanced algorithm. It creates a continuous, random stream of numbers that governs game outcomes. The casino does not certify these RNGs itself. Independent third-party testing labs handle that. Their audits check that the RNG is genuinely random, statistically fair, and unaffected. This ensures every spin, every card dealt, and every dice roll is a matter of pure chance.

Game Integrity and Player Returns

Game integrity encompasses the fairness of chance-based results and the clarity of game rules and payouts. A essential element of this is the published Return to Player (RTP) rate. This value is a percentage. It shows the anticipated amount of money bet a game will pay back to participants over a long term. Take a slot with a 96% RTP. Over millions of spins, it should in theory give back $96 for every $100 staked. Lotto Casino offers the RTP for its games. This allows informed players make choices. Keep in mind, RTP is a average statistic. It is no guarantee for any single playing period. Gaming sites with great honesty ensure these numbers are correct and can be verified through audit logs.
